摘要:隨著互聯(lián)網(wǎng)的普及和企業(yè)對線上市場的重視,企業(yè)網(wǎng)站建設(shè)成為了一項(xiàng)關(guān)鍵任務(wù)。本文主要介紹了企業(yè)網(wǎng)站建設(shè)方案中的技術(shù)選型與開發(fā)流程。首先,我們將詳細(xì)討論網(wǎng)站建設(shè)的技術(shù)選型,包括前端技術(shù)、后端技術(shù)、數(shù)據(jù)庫技術(shù)以及服務(wù)器技術(shù)的選擇。然后,我們將介紹企業(yè)網(wǎng)站開發(fā)的流程,包括需求分析、UI設(shè)計(jì)、前后端開發(fā)、測試與上線等環(huán)節(jié)。非常后,我們將分享一些企業(yè)網(wǎng)站建設(shè)的非常佳實(shí)踐,幫助企業(yè)更好地進(jìn)行網(wǎng)站建設(shè)。
關(guān)鍵詞:企業(yè)網(wǎng)站建設(shè)、技術(shù)選型、開發(fā)流程、前端技術(shù)、后端技術(shù)、數(shù)據(jù)庫技術(shù)、服務(wù)器技術(shù)、需求分析、UI設(shè)計(jì)、前后端開發(fā)、測試與上線、非常佳實(shí)踐
一、引言
隨著互聯(lián)網(wǎng)技術(shù)的快速發(fā)展和企業(yè)對線上市場的日益重視,企業(yè)網(wǎng)站建設(shè)變得越來越重要。一個(gè)杰出的企業(yè)網(wǎng)站不僅可以提升企業(yè)形象,還可以為企業(yè)帶來更多的商機(jī)。然而,企業(yè)網(wǎng)站建設(shè)并非一項(xiàng)簡單的任務(wù),需要全面考慮技術(shù)選型與開發(fā)流程,才能保證網(wǎng)站的高效穩(wěn)定運(yùn)行。
二、技術(shù)選型
2.1 前端技術(shù)選型
在企業(yè)網(wǎng)站建設(shè)中,前端技術(shù)的選型至關(guān)重要。杰出的前端技術(shù)可以提供良好的用戶體驗(yàn)和高效的頁面加載速度。常用的前端技術(shù)包括HTML、CSS、JavaScript等。此外,考慮到不同終端的兼容性,響應(yīng)式設(shè)計(jì)也是前端技術(shù)選型的一個(gè)重要方面。
2.2 后端技術(shù)選型
后端技術(shù)的選型也是企業(yè)網(wǎng)站建設(shè)中的關(guān)鍵環(huán)節(jié)。后端技術(shù)主要負(fù)責(zé)網(wǎng)站的業(yè)務(wù)邏輯和數(shù)據(jù)處理。常用的后端技術(shù)包括Java、Python、PHP等。選擇合適的后端技術(shù)可以提高網(wǎng)站的性能和安全性。
2.3 數(shù)據(jù)庫技術(shù)選型
數(shù)據(jù)庫技術(shù)在企業(yè)網(wǎng)站建設(shè)中起著至關(guān)重要的作用。數(shù)據(jù)庫用于存儲和管理網(wǎng)站的數(shù)據(jù),對網(wǎng)站的性能和數(shù)據(jù)安全性有直接影響。常用的數(shù)據(jù)庫技術(shù)包括MySQL、Oracle、MongoDB等。選擇合適的數(shù)據(jù)庫技術(shù)要根據(jù)網(wǎng)站的數(shù)據(jù)規(guī)模和訪問量來確定。
2.4 服務(wù)器技術(shù)選型
服務(wù)器技術(shù)的選擇也是企業(yè)網(wǎng)站建設(shè)的重要環(huán)節(jié)。服務(wù)器技術(shù)主要負(fù)責(zé)網(wǎng)站的托管和運(yùn)行。常用的服務(wù)器技術(shù)包括Apache、Nginx、IIS等。選擇合適的服務(wù)器技術(shù)可以提高網(wǎng)站的穩(wěn)定性和性能。
三、開發(fā)流程
3.1 需求分析
在網(wǎng)站建設(shè)之前,需要進(jìn)行詳細(xì)的需求分析,了解企業(yè)對網(wǎng)站的期望和功能要求。需求分析包括用戶需求調(diào)研、功能規(guī)劃和技術(shù)可行性評估等。只有清晰明確的需求分析,才能為后續(xù)的開發(fā)工作提供有力的指導(dǎo)。
3.2 UI設(shè)計(jì)
UI設(shè)計(jì)是網(wǎng)站建設(shè)中的重要環(huán)節(jié),直接決定了網(wǎng)站的用戶界面和用戶體驗(yàn)。UI設(shè)計(jì)需要考慮企業(yè)的品牌形象和用戶需求,同時(shí)也要兼顧美觀和實(shí)用性。在UI設(shè)計(jì)過程中,需要充分與用戶溝通,收集反饋,并根據(jù)情況進(jìn)行適當(dāng)?shù)恼{(diào)整和優(yōu)化。
3.3 前后端開發(fā)
在需求分析和UI設(shè)計(jì)完成之后,可以開始進(jìn)行前后端開發(fā)工作。前端開發(fā)主要負(fù)責(zé)網(wǎng)站的頁面設(shè)計(jì)和交互邏輯,后端開發(fā)主要負(fù)責(zé)網(wǎng)站的業(yè)務(wù)邏輯和數(shù)據(jù)處理。前后端開發(fā)需要充分協(xié)作,確保網(wǎng)站的功能和性能符合預(yù)期。
3.4 測試與上線
在開發(fā)完成之后,需要進(jìn)行全面的測試工作,確保網(wǎng)站的穩(wěn)定性和可靠性。測試包括功能測試、性能測試、安全測試等。通過嚴(yán)格的測試,可以發(fā)現(xiàn)和修復(fù)潛在的問題,提高網(wǎng)站的質(zhì)量。測試完成后,可以進(jìn)行網(wǎng)站的上線工作,使其正式對外提供服務(wù)。
四、非常佳實(shí)踐
4.1 注意網(wǎng)站的安全性
企業(yè)網(wǎng)站中可能存儲著大量敏感數(shù)據(jù),因此安全性至關(guān)重要。建議采用加密傳輸、訪問控制、漏洞掃描等措施,保障網(wǎng)站的數(shù)據(jù)安全。
4.2 注重用戶體驗(yàn)
一個(gè)良好的用戶體驗(yàn)可以使用戶更好地了解企業(yè)和產(chǎn)品,提高轉(zhuǎn)化率。建議注重頁面加載速度、響應(yīng)式設(shè)計(jì)、友好的用戶界面等,提升用戶體驗(yàn)。
4.3 定期維護(hù)和更新
企業(yè)網(wǎng)站需要定期維護(hù)和更新,以保持其功能的穩(wěn)定和升級。建議制定合理的維護(hù)計(jì)劃,及時(shí)修復(fù)漏洞和更新功能,提高網(wǎng)站的性能和安全性。
企業(yè)網(wǎng)站建設(shè)方案中的技術(shù)選型與開發(fā)流程是確保網(wǎng)站成功建設(shè)的關(guān)鍵因素。通過合理選擇前端技術(shù)、后端技術(shù)、數(shù)據(jù)庫技術(shù)和服務(wù)器技術(shù),并按照需求分析、UI設(shè)計(jì)、前后端開發(fā)、測試與上線的流程進(jìn)行開發(fā),可以高效地完成企業(yè)網(wǎng)站的建設(shè)任務(wù)。